当前位置:首页 > 虚拟机 > 正文

虚拟机快照(虚拟机不能恢复快照)


一、什么是虚拟机的快照?

虚拟机快照是虚拟机在特定时间点的副本。

虚拟机快照是特定时间段内特定文件系统的只读镜像。换句话说,如果用户需要反复返回到特定的系统状态并且不想创建多个虚拟机,则可以使用虚拟机快照功能。

当发生系统崩溃或系统异常时,您可以在升级和修补应用程序和服务器时将磁盘文件系统和系统存储恢复到快照。快照就像一个救世主。



工作原理

创建虚拟机快照的本质是记录虚拟机在特定时间点的磁盘数据。以KVM为例,KVM虚拟机磁盘使用qCow2格式的镜像文件。因此,虚拟机的磁盘计数记录了虚拟机在某个时间点的磁盘数据。qCow2图像文件。

虚拟机快照生成的数据与虚拟机的磁盘数据存储在同一个qCow2镜像文件中,因此存储位置就是虚拟机本身的存储位置。虚拟机位置无法访问,其他快照也无法恢复。

qCow2快照使用“CopyOnWrite”技术,这意味着当您创建快照时,会复制原始磁盘索引的副本,并且实际数据成为该磁盘的数据。仅限原版光盘。当原始镜像中的数据发生变化时,将原始变化区域中的数据复制到快照中的相应位置。所以,创建快照时数据比较小,但后来就越来越大。


二、对于虚拟机来说,快照和备份有什么异同之处?告诉你一下,对于虚拟机来说,保存状态的方式有3种:
1快照;
3详细解释如下:
1快照:主要是指拍快照在进行系统配置或关键操作之前,这样如果操作出现问题,可以在下次开机时直接恢复快照状态。不影响系统的使用。该操作简单易行,快照文件占用空间小,耗时短。用完后可以直接删除;
2:主要是指对虚拟机系统进行整体备份,方法很原始,但是往往比较耗时,会浪费大量磁盘空间,比较麻烦;
3系统当前的配置状态,但是当关闭并重​​新启动时,它就会消失。通常主要用于安装、升级软件或编译等非常长的操作。
如有问题欢迎继续沟通!